Output e0584641ee0c168097ad45493c12a2b6854b05c132740de97d762bb6f71a41a4:0

value
598056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9515d5c2ff3d1abf5cc6bb6107d75362afb920c OP_EQUALVERIFY OP_CHECKSIG
address
Lf32NA7E8kbBU6rQWfNUuBuM1psJhNThRo
transaction
e0584641ee0c168097ad45493c12a2b6854b05c132740de97d762bb6f71a41a4
spent
true